Altered States of Consciousness
After learning about the altered states of consciousness, I learned a lot of new methods, other than sleep, to do this. On the weekends sometimes I go to yoga with my friend, which is a way that I relax and can alter my state of consciousness. While doing yoga, I am very in touch with my inner self and I am very aware of all of my senses and my body. It helps me to clear my thoughts, relax, and escape the realities of the world for 45 minutes. I have learned that there are many alternatives to doing drugs that can alter your states of consciousness in a healthy and natural way. In order for me to experience more "flow" experience, I can read a book that I enjoy. When I read books that I am immersed in and that I enjoy reading, I lose my perception of time and my surroundings, and it feels as if it is only me and the book that's involved. This feeling is nice to have sometimes because all of the other emotions, feelings, and thoughts that I normally have going through my head are not there anymore.
